Problem with Sustain on Yamaha SO8

by Lisa
(NC)

Help!!! The sustain pedal works backwards on a "new" SO8. Any suggestions on getting it to work the right way? Thanks

sustain pedal
by: Anonymous

With my keyboard, you have to plug in the sustain pedal first and then power on the keyboard or it works backwards. Have you tried that?

I found the answer today
by: Anonymous

Hi there,

Just turn the pedal over and there should be a switch on the bottom. Flip it and your problem should be solved.

p.s. It may be a little hard to see.
